Just because we recruited him hard, doesn't mean we wouldn't tell him to hold off until February to sign. By February, you have a better picture of a recruit's academic standing.

Also, the NCAA passed a rule that said that we can no longer back count an academic casualty's spot, making it all the more important that the recruit qualifies because now you lose that spot altogether.
